To bring up something that is best left alone and thereby cause unnecessary trouble or provoke a dormant issue (literally 'to wake a sleeping child'). An idiomatic expression.
あの話はもう終わったことだから、今さら蒸し返すと寝た子を起こすだけだ。
That matter is already settled; bringing it up again now will only wake a sleeping child (needlessly stir things up).
会議で問題点を指摘するのは重要だが、今は時期が悪くて寝た子を起こすかもしれない。
It's important to point out issues in meetings, but now might be a bad time—you might be stirring up trouble.
余計な言葉で寝た子を起こすことのないよう、発言には注意した。
I was careful with my remarks so as not to wake a sleeping child with unnecessary words.
